On Sun, 2003-06-22 at 00:05, Bruce Momjian wrote: > Bruce Momjian wrote: > > > > Reading the subject, "creepy ... dates", that is exactly how I feel > > about the described current date behavior --- "creepy". > > > > Because I have only seen one person defend our current behavior, and > > many object, I am going to add to TODO: > > > > * Allow current datestyle to restrict dates; prevent month/day swapping > > from making invalid dates valid? > > * Prevent month/day swapping of ISO dates to make invalid dates valid > > I added a question mark to the first item so we can consider it later. > Most agreed on the second item, but a few thought the first one might be > OK as is. How about situations where reversing the month and date would still have "valid but wrong" dates, based upon the LOCALE mask? I.e., "05/04/2003" is "05-April-2003" or "04-May-2003", depending on whether the LOCALE implies "DD/MM/YYYY" or "MM/DD/YYYY". -- +-----------------------------------------------------------+ | Ron Johnson, Jr. Home: ron.l.johnson@cox.net | | Jefferson, LA USA http://members.cox.net/ron.l.johnson | | | | "Oh, great altar of passive entertainment, bestow upon me | | thy discordant images at such speed as to render linear | | thought impossible" (Calvin, regarding TV) | +-----------------------------------------------------------
